A.J. Green, WR Cin

This man was a hot topic this week. I was getting a ton of questions asking if A.J. Green should be in their starting lineup. My answer to them was, “why would you not?”

A lot of fantasy owners are afraid to pull the trigger because of what happened last time Green faced off against the Cleveland Browns, he was smothered by All-Pro Joe Haden; who held him to just three receptions for 23 yards and zero touchdowns. I’ m here to tell you: do not be foolish–start the man! Green has performed well against the cornerback scoring three touchdowns and going over the century mark twice. He has been impressive facing Haden at FirstEnergy Stadium averaging five catches for 75 yards and a touchdown over three games.

And let’s not forget the performance that Haden allowed last week to T.Y. Hilton, who destroyed the cornerback to the tune of 10 catches for 150 yards and two touchdowns. This guy is beatable and we shall see a different Green then the one that showed up Week 10. Green will be a Top 10 receiver for the week and finish the game with his third career 100-yard game against Haden and also hitting pay dirt.

Johnny Manziel, QB Cle

With Johnny Football getting his first career start, fantasy owners are ready to see what this guy has to offer. Sorry to tell you guys it’s not going to be much.

In his first game as a starter Manziel will be going up against the Cincinnati Bengals who are the seventh stingiest defense against the quarterback, allowing 14 fantasy points per game to the position. Up until last week’s debacle against Pittsburgh, the Cincinnati secondary hadn’t allowed a quarterback to throw multiple touchdowns since Week 9 and had not allowed a QB to throw for more than 300 yards since Week 7. In their last three road games the Bengals have allowed 634 passing yards, one touchdown, and two interceptions. Another ugly stat for Manziel owners: the Bengals have held four of the last seven quarterbacks they faced to under 10 fantasy points.

I think the Browns’ coaches will be leaning on the run more this game and not trying to rely on Manziel’s arm much. I see Manziel being held to under 160 passing yards, two interceptions and 47 rushing yards and a rushing touchdown. Manziel is outside my Top 20 at quarterback for the week.
